One Pan Creamy Chicken Enchilada Pasta

An easy one pan pasta dish that tastes just like chicken enchiladas, without all of the work
Course Main
Cuisine Mexican
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Servings 6 to 8 servings
Calories 607kcal
Author Dee

Ingredients

  • 1 pound chicken tenders cut into small pieces
  • ½ cup chopped yellow or white onion
  • 1 teaspoon sea salt
  • ½ teaspoon garlic powder
  • ½ te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 2 cups mini penne pasta uncooked
  • 2 cups water
  • 1 cup cream
  • 2 cups mild enchilada sauce
  • 2 ½ cups shredded cheddar or Mexican blend cheese
  • Sour cream guacamole, tomatoes and cilantro for garnish (optional)
  • ½ cup crushed tortilla chips
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il

Instructions

  • In a large skillet brown the chicken and onions in olive oil
  • Add the salt, pepper, cumin and garlic powder
  • Stir in pasta, water and enchilada sauce, cover and cook over over high heat until pasta is almost tender
  • Reduce heat to medium, stir in cream and cook until pasta is tender
  • Top with cheese, tortilla chips and optional ingredients
  • Serve immediately
